Why a Gas Stove Heat Diffuser Is Necessary

I found that a gas stove heat diffuser is necessary because it helps spread the flame more evenly across the bottom of my cookware. Without it, I often noticed hot spots that could burn food in one area while leaving another part undercooked. The diffuser gives me much better control, especially when I’m simmering sauces, melting chocolate, or cooking delicate dishes that need gentle heat.

My cookware also lasts longer when I use a heat diffuser. Direct flame can be too intense for some pots and pans, and I’ve seen how uneven heating can cause warping or discoloration over time. With a diffuser in place, the heat becomes softer and more balanced, which protects both my food and my cookware.

I also like that it makes cooking easier on low heat. My gas stove can sometimes be too powerful, even on the lowest setting, but the diffuser helps reduce that intensity. For me, it’s a simple tool that improves cooking results, adds consistency, and makes my kitchen experience much more reliable.

What I Look for in a Heat Diffuser

When I choose a heat diffuser, I pay attention to a few important things. I want something that fits my burner well, handles heat safely, and works with the cookware I already own. I also prefer a diffuser that is easy to clean and strong enough to last through regular use.

Material and Build Quality

I usually look for diffusers made from durable materials like stainless steel, cast iron, or aluminum with a sturdy base. In my experience, stainless steel is lightweight and easy to maintain, while cast iron holds heat well but can be heavier. I avoid flimsy products because they may warp or wear out faster.

Size and Burner Compatibility

Before I buy one, I check the size of my stove burner and compare it with the diffuser diameter. If it is too small, it may not spread heat properly. If it is too large, it may not sit securely. I always make sure the diffuser matches the burner I use most often.

Heat Distribution Performance

The main reason I use a diffuser is to improve heat control. I prefer models that distribute heat evenly without creating too much delay in cooking. For me, the best diffuser helps reduce burning while still allowing food to cook at a consistent temperature.

Handle and Safety Features

I like diffusers that come with a handle or removable grip because they make it easier for me to move the diffuser without getting too close to the flame. Heat-resistant handles and stable designs matter a lot to me since I want to cook safely and comfortably.

Ease of Cleaning

Cleaning is another thing I consider carefully. I prefer a diffuser that I can wipe down quickly after use. If it has too many grooves or hard-to-reach areas, I know it will take more effort to maintain. A simple design usually works best for me.

Best Uses in My Kitchen

I find a gas stove heat diffuser most useful for delicate cooking tasks. It helps me when I am making sauces, simmering soups, reheating leftovers gently, or keeping food warm. I also use it when I want to avoid direct flame contact with sensitive cookware.
